Check for Unclaimed Property

  
 

Indiana residents are encouraged to see if they are eligible to claim unclaimed property totaling $66 million.

Unclaimed property includes investment earnings, insurance proceeds and benefits, wages, and money from savings and checking accounts. Attorney General Greg Zoeller said making a claim with the Attorney General’s Unclaimed Property Division is free. Visit www.IndianaUnclaimed.gov search for your name, relatives, neighbors and friends names. Business owners and charitable organizations should also check annually for unclaimed property.

The state holds these assets for 25 years after they are reported.

In Starke County, $822,699 is claimable while in Pulaski County $381,305 is claimable.

In 2014, the Attorney General’s Office returned a record 95,000 properties totaling more than $66 million in unclaimed property.
